Vegas Scroll Mode - Plugin Developer Guide
Vegas scroll mode displays content from multiple plugins in a continuous horizontal scroll, similar to the news tickers seen in Las Vegas casinos. This guide explains how to integrate your plugin with Vegas mode.
Overview
When Vegas mode is enabled, the display controller composes content from all enabled plugins into a single continuous scroll. Each plugin can control how its content appears in the scroll using one of three display modes:
| Mode | Behavior | Best For |
|---|---|---|
| SCROLL | Content scrolls continuously within the stream | Multi-item plugins (sports scores, odds, news) |
| FIXED_SEGMENT | Fixed-width block that scrolls by | Static info (clock, weather, current temp) |
| STATIC | Scroll pauses, plugin displays for duration, then resumes | Important alerts, detailed views |
Quick Start
Minimal Integration (Zero Code Changes)
If you do nothing, your plugin will work with Vegas mode using these defaults:
- Plugins with
get_vegas_content_type() == 'multi'use SCROLL mode - Plugins with
get_vegas_content_type() == 'static'use FIXED_SEGMENT mode - Content is captured by calling your plugin's
display()method
Basic Integration
To provide optimized Vegas content, implement get_vegas_content():
from PIL import Image
class MyPlugin(BasePlugin):
def get_vegas_content(self):
"""Return content for Vegas scroll mode."""
# Return a single image for fixed content
return self._render_current_view()
# OR return multiple images for multi-item content
# return [self._render_item(item) for item in self.items]
Full Integration
For complete control over Vegas behavior, implement these methods:
from src.plugin_system.base_plugin import BasePlugin, VegasDisplayMode
class MyPlugin(BasePlugin):
def get_vegas_content_type(self) -> str:
"""Legacy method - determines default mode mapping."""
return 'multi' # or 'static' or 'none'
def get_vegas_display_mode(self) -> VegasDisplayMode:
"""Specify how this plugin behaves in Vegas scroll."""
return VegasDisplayMode.SCROLL
def get_supported_vegas_modes(self) -> list:
"""Return list of modes users can configure."""
return [VegasDisplayMode.SCROLL, VegasDisplayMode.FIXED_SEGMENT]
def get_vegas_content(self):
"""Return PIL Image(s) for the scroll."""
return [self._render_game(g) for g in self.games]
def get_vegas_segment_width(self) -> int:
"""For FIXED_SEGMENT: width in panels (optional)."""
return 2 # Use 2 panels width
Display Modes Explained
SCROLL Mode
Content scrolls continuously within the Vegas stream. Best for plugins with multiple items.
def get_vegas_display_mode(self):
return VegasDisplayMode.SCROLL
def get_vegas_content(self):
# Return list of images - each scrolls individually
images = []
for game in self.games:
img = Image.new('RGB', (200, 32))
# ... render game info ...
images.append(img)
return images
When to use:
- Sports scores with multiple games
- Stock/odds tickers with multiple items
- News feeds with multiple headlines
FIXED_SEGMENT Mode
Content is rendered as a fixed-width block that scrolls by with other content.
def get_vegas_display_mode(self):
return VegasDisplayMode.FIXED_SEGMENT
def get_vegas_content(self):
# Return single image at your preferred width
img = Image.new('RGB', (128, 32)) # 2 panels wide
# ... render clock/weather/etc ...
return img
def get_vegas_segment_width(self):
# Optional: specify width in panels
return 2
When to use:
- Clock display
- Current weather/temperature
- System status indicators
- Any "at a glance" information
STATIC Mode
Scroll pauses completely, your plugin displays using its normal display() method for its configured duration, then scroll resumes.
def get_vegas_display_mode(self):
return VegasDisplayMode.STATIC
def get_display_duration(self):
# How long to pause and show this plugin
return 10.0 # 10 seconds
When to use:
- Important alerts that need attention
- Detailed information that's hard to read while scrolling
- Interactive or animated content
- Content that requires the full display
User Configuration
Users can override the default display mode per-plugin in their config:
{
"my_plugin": {
"enabled": true,
"vegas_mode": "static", // Override: "scroll", "fixed", or "static"
"vegas_panel_count": 2, // Width in panels for fixed mode
"display_duration": 10 // Duration for static mode
}
}
The get_vegas_display_mode() method checks config first, then falls back to your implementation.
Content Rendering Guidelines
Image Dimensions
- Height: Must match display height (typically 32 pixels)
- Width:
- SCROLL: Any width, content will scroll
- FIXED_SEGMENT:
panels × single_panel_width(e.g., 2 × 64 = 128px)
Color Mode
Always use RGB mode for images:
img = Image.new('RGB', (width, 32), color=(0, 0, 0))
Performance Tips
- Cache rendered images - Don't re-render on every call
- Pre-render on update() - Render images when data changes, not when Vegas requests them
- Keep images small - Memory adds up with multiple plugins
class MyPlugin(BasePlugin):
def __init__(self, ...):
super().__init__(...)
self._cached_vegas_images = None
self._cache_valid = False
def update(self):
# Fetch new data
self.data = self._fetch_data()
# Invalidate cache so next Vegas request re-renders
self._cache_valid = False
def get_vegas_content(self):
if not self._cache_valid:
self._cached_vegas_images = self._render_all_items()
self._cache_valid = True
return self._cached_vegas_images
Fallback Behavior
If your plugin doesn't implement get_vegas_content(), Vegas mode will:
- Create a temporary canvas matching display dimensions
- Call your
display()method - Capture the resulting image
- Use that image in the scroll
This works but is less efficient than providing native Vegas content.
Excluding from Vegas Mode
To exclude your plugin from Vegas scroll entirely:
def get_vegas_content_type(self):
return 'none'
Or users can exclude via config:
{
"display": {
"vegas_scroll": {
"excluded_plugins": ["my_plugin"]
}
}
}
Complete Example
Here's a complete example of a weather plugin with full Vegas integration:
from PIL import Image, ImageDraw
from src.plugin_system.base_plugin import BasePlugin, VegasDisplayMode
class WeatherPlugin(BasePlugin):
def __init__(self, *args, **kwargs):
super().__init__(*args, **kwargs)
self.temperature = None
self.conditions = None
self._vegas_image = None
def update(self):
"""Fetch weather data."""
data = self._fetch_weather_api()
self.temperature = data['temp']
self.conditions = data['conditions']
self._vegas_image = None # Invalidate cache
def display(self, force_clear=False):
"""Standard display for normal rotation."""
if force_clear:
self.display_manager.clear()
# Full weather display with details
self.display_manager.draw_text(
f"{self.temperature}°F",
x=10, y=8, color=(255, 255, 255)
)
self.display_manager.draw_text(
self.conditions,
x=10, y=20, color=(200, 200, 200)
)
self.display_manager.update_display()
# --- Vegas Mode Integration ---
def get_vegas_content_type(self):
"""Legacy compatibility."""
return 'static'
def get_vegas_display_mode(self):
"""Use FIXED_SEGMENT for compact weather display."""
# Allow user override via config
return super().get_vegas_display_mode()
def get_supported_vegas_modes(self):
"""Weather can work as fixed or static."""
return [VegasDisplayMode.FIXED_SEGMENT, VegasDisplayMode.STATIC]
def get_vegas_segment_width(self):
"""Weather needs 2 panels to show clearly."""
return self.config.get('vegas_panel_count', 2)
def get_vegas_content(self):
"""Render compact weather for Vegas scroll."""
if self._vegas_image is not None:
return self._vegas_image
# Create compact display (2 panels = 128px typical)
panel_width = 64 # From display.hardware.cols
panels = self.get_vegas_segment_width() or 2
width = panel_width * panels
height = 32
img = Image.new('RGB', (width, height), color=(0, 0, 40))
draw = ImageDraw.Draw(img)
# Draw compact weather
temp_text = f"{self.temperature}°"
draw.text((10, 8), temp_text, fill=(255, 255, 255))
draw.text((60, 8), self.conditions[:10], fill=(200, 200, 200))
self._vegas_image = img
return img
API Reference
VegasDisplayMode Enum
from src.plugin_system.base_plugin import VegasDisplayMode
VegasDisplayMode.SCROLL # "scroll" - continuous scrolling
VegasDisplayMode.FIXED_SEGMENT # "fixed" - fixed block in scroll
VegasDisplayMode.STATIC # "static" - pause scroll to display
BasePlugin Vegas Methods
| Method | Returns | Description |
|---|---|---|
get_vegas_content() |
Image or List[Image] or None |
Content for Vegas scroll |
get_vegas_content_type() |
str |
Legacy: 'multi', 'static', or 'none' |
get_vegas_display_mode() |
VegasDisplayMode |
How plugin behaves in Vegas |
get_supported_vegas_modes() |
List[VegasDisplayMode] |
Modes available for user config |
get_vegas_segment_width() |
int or None |
Width in panels for FIXED_SEGMENT |
Configuration Options
Per-plugin config:
{
"plugin_id": {
"vegas_mode": "scroll|fixed|static",
"vegas_panel_count": 2,
"display_duration": 15
}
}
Global Vegas config:
{
"display": {
"vegas_scroll": {
"enabled": true,
"scroll_speed": 50,
"separator_width": 32,
"plugin_order": ["clock", "weather", "sports"],
"excluded_plugins": ["debug_plugin"],
"target_fps": 125,
"buffer_ahead": 2
}
}
}
Troubleshooting
Plugin not appearing in Vegas scroll
- Check
get_vegas_content_type()doesn't return'none' - Verify plugin is not in
excluded_pluginslist - Ensure plugin is enabled
Content looks wrong in scroll
- Verify image height matches display height (32px typical)
- Check image mode is 'RGB'
- Test with
get_vegas_content()returning a simple test image
STATIC mode not pausing
- Verify
get_vegas_display_mode()returnsVegasDisplayMode.STATIC - Check user hasn't overridden with
vegas_modein config - Ensure
display()method works correctly
Performance issues
- Implement image caching in
get_vegas_content() - Pre-render images in
update()instead of on-demand - Reduce image dimensions if possible
